Syble was born on December 23, 1916 in Dodson, Panola County Texas. Syble was the daughter of Lonnie F. and Monnie Griffin Wedgeworth.
Syble was a graduate of Timpson High School and a member of First Baptist Church, Timpson.
Syble married Jim Frank Keeling on August 25, 1934. Syble was a faithful and loving companion supporting her husband in his educational career as a teacher and later as the Superintendent of Gary Schools in Gary, Texas. Syble also loved spending time with Jim Frank and their two girls at their farm raising cows and watching the timber grow. In late years, Syble’s greatest joy was her 8 grandchildren, 19 great grandchildren, and 3 great-great grandchildren.
Syble was preceded in death by her parents, her husband, two sisters, Christine Wedgeworth Champagne and Gwenith Wedgeworth Tyer, her sister-in-law Barbara Wedgeworth, and also her son-in-law James Newman.
Survivors include daughter Martha Nell Keeling Newman, daughter Vicki Ann Keeling Bush and husband Gene Bush, and brother, L.F. Wedgeworth; nephew Mike Champagne, and niece Kay Tyer Nix. Grandchildren Keith Newman, Kerry Newman and wife Debra, Leigh Ann Weaver and husband John, Amy Yates and husband Mike, Shelly Sitton and husband Johnny, Janan Moore and husband Marks, David Bush and wife Jana, Mark Bush and wife Jenny; along with a host of great and great-great grandchildren.
